Total Nitrogen Unit for TOC-L Series

Perform Simultaneous TOC and TN Measurements
- 720 °C catalytic thermal decomposition/chemiluminescence methods are adopted for TN measurement. There is no interference from metallic ions or bromine in sea water.
- Measurements over a wide range with a detection limit of 5 μg/L for TOC-LCH to an upper limit of 10,000 mg/L.
(In the case of simultaneous TOC/TN measurement, TOC analysis using high-sensitivity catalysts is impossible.)

Shimadzu Introduces the TOC-1000e S Online Analyzer for Ultrapure Water Monitoring in Semiconductor Manufacturing
Shimadzu Scientific Instruments introduces the TOC-1000e S Online Total Organic Carbon (TOC) Analyzer, engineered to meet the increasingly stringent ultrapure water quality requirements of advanced semiconductor manufacturing. As semiconductor miniaturization continues to advance, even trace-level organic contamination in ultrapure water can directly impact process stability and yield, making precise, reliable monitoring of TOC essential.
